HC Deb 20 June 1956 vol 554 c1426
36. Mrs. Jeger

asked the Secretary of State for the Colonies when he expects a report regarding the complaints of ill-treatment in the village of Phrenaros to be available.

Mr. Lennox-Boyd

Police investigations have been completed and reveal no sufficient grounds for proceedings against either members of the security forces or the several persons who appear to have made false allegations of ill-treatment. Apart from the investigation of certain complaints in a letter forwarded to me by the hon. Member and now under reference to Cyprus, the inquiry into this incident has been closed.
